February the 30th

 

I unlocked the door to my humble little apartment – well, our humble little apartment.

 It was small, but cozy. Or at least it usually is.

But of course there is always the exception, and today is one of them.

Despite the fact that it was just the beginning of summer, I shivered.

 It was chilly,

I turned off the air conditioner.

Dark,

I flicked on the lights.

And lonely.

I sighed. Well, couldn’t fix that one.

 

I entered the kitchen and flicking on the lights, made my way to my miniature dining table.

Actually, our dining table. Technically, he bought it for me as a present when we moved in, but I was nice enough to share.

I chuckled softly at the memory. I had given him the cold shoulder for two hours straight because I thought he was implying I should cook more. That didn't happen.

Gingerly and carefully, I placed the delicate stem of carnation into the glass vase. I admired my work of art, a proud smile on my face.

There! Now everything’s perfect.

All his favourite dishes were there: Galbi, Bruschetta, French fries – yes, he loves French fries – Haemul pajeon, Fusilli with Basil Chicken, you name it.

If there’s one thing that guy was best at, it was definitely eating. To be honest, Minho usually does all the cooking so I don’t normally complain about his appetite. But I did spend hours preparing this feast, so I at least have some right to complain.

All the cutleries were set and I even bothered folding the napkins into neat little triangles. We had both agreed that triangles were cooler than swans.

I glanced at our old grandfather clock. It was only 4 o’clock. His plane is supposed to arrive at 7, and even then, our house is a good 2-hour drive from the airport.

Guess I have some time to kill.

My eyes landed on our old bookshelf; the one piled high with our high school yearbooks, journals, and sitting on the highest shelf, a thick leather-bound photo album.

It was a treasure trove of past adventures and forgotten memories.

I brushed off the thin film of dust that had gathered on the jacket of the album over the course of time.

How long has it been since I’ve last opened this? Three, four years?

It has been too long, or at least too long for me to remember. But I have a horrible memory, so that doesn’t say much.

I was planning to wait until he gets back so we can reminisce, cry, laugh, and maybe even remember old stories together, but he probably wouldn’t mind if I got a head start.

Besides, he had a horrible habit of not telling me beforehand if he couldn’t make it back for dinner.

I flipped open to the first page. It was a photograph – of a little girl and boy holding hands posing in front of a playground.

I squinted down at the little girl and stared disapprovingly at the fluffy pink dress.

Ew. Did I really wear that?

My eyes moved to the boy standing next to her. I almost gagged.

Did Minho’s hair really look like that??

Like I said, I have a horrible memory. And I thanked the gods that there was such a thing as growing up.

Growing up…we practically – no wait, I lied – we did grow up together. It was like a not-so-magical fairytale, the story of Princess Haneul and Prince Minho.

 Except he’s not just a prince and I’m not just a princess; he’s my prince and I’m his princess. I’ll change the title.

 The Tale of Minho’s Princess Haneul and Her Prince Minho.

 I smiled. For some strange reason, I liked the sound of that.

 

And here begins our story…
